These cards use the RicRac Scalloped Pierceability die set (S4-166 with an MSRP of $19.99).

s4-166.jpg

As with all of the Spellbinder’s dies, you can cut, emboss, and stencil with these. In addition to that, they are piercing templates! Genius I tell ya! PURE GENIUS! They are also perfect for using with the Copic Airbrush system as seen here:
